Abstract

Macroscale and microscale processes of removal of atmospheric metals from the atmosphere by precipitation and fog water deposition are described. Methodologies for measuring wet deposition are critically examined. Finally, pitfalls in using historical measurements of metals deposition and scavenging ratios to estimate removal are discussed.
